Monaco Grand Prix – Free practice results (1)

CLICK HERE for the full Monaco Grand Prix FP1 report Full free practice results (1) for round six of the 2015 Formula 1 World Championship (F1), the Monaco Grand Prix. 1. Lewis Hamilton GBR Mercedes-Mercedes 1m 18.750s 2. Max Verstappen NED Toro Rosso-Renault 1m 18.899s 3. Daniel Ricciardo AUS Red Bull-Renault 1m 19.086s 4. Sebastian Vettel GER Ferrari-Ferrari 1m 19.134s 5. Carlos Sainz Jr Toro Rosso-Renault 1m 19.245s 6. Pastor Maldonado VEN Lotus-Mercedes 1m 19.454s 7. Daniil Kvyat RUS Red Bull-Renault 1m 19.520s 8. Kimi Raikkonen FIN Ferrari-Ferrari 1m 19.679s 9. Nico Rosberg GER Mercedes-Mercedes 1m 19.762s 10.Felipe Massa BRZ Williams-Mercedes 1m 19.766s 11. Fernando Alonso...
